When the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ars are back at the zero line, price has completed an old price swing and is building a new price swing. This means that it has reached an indecision spot:

The above chart shows purple arrows, which indicate each time the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ars cross the zero line. Each crossing of that zero line indicates the end of a price swing and wave pattern too.

Although we will not dive into all the facets of wave analysis in this sub paragraph of today’s article, we did want to provide an overview of how the the Awesome Oscillator (AO) works together with wave analysis. Once again, the AO is a great wave trend oscillator for the MT4 and works well for any trend wave strategy.
The AO bars are showing a first stronger push away from the zero line, often into the opposite direction of the previous swing.
A shallow retracement back to the zero line occurs, but the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ars do not go much into the opposite direction.
Strong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ars push away from the zero line. Keep in mind that the wave 3 might become extended and hence you might see several strong pushes away from the zero line. Some of these pushes could all be part of a larger wave 3.
Eventually the strong wave 3 will finish and a larger retracement will take place back to the zero line, which could easily occur on a higher time frame as well because waves 4 are often lengthy.
The last push in the trend. The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ars move away from the 0 line but not as much as the wave 3, which creates divergence because price does often make a higher high but the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ave does not.
The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ars were closer to the zero line usually because the trend is becoming slower. The first counter trend move shows impulse as the AO bars cross the zero line and keep their speed, moving into the opposite direction.
A last push with the previous trend but the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ars hardly cross the zero line any more.
The larger correction continues as a large push creates a 3rd counter trend wave.
When a triangle or wedge chart pattern takes place, the Awesome Oscillator Elliott Wave bars will be mostly hanging around the zero line.
